ClouderaNOW24     See the latest Cloudera Innovations

Watch now

Data mesh FAQs

What is a data mesh?

In recent years, data has become an incredibly valuable asset for organizations of all sizes and across all industries. However, as data has grown in importance, so too have the challenges associated with managing and using it effectively. This is where the concept of a data mesh comes in.

A data mesh is a new way of thinking about data architecture that aims to address some of the most pressing challenges associated with data management. At its core, a data mesh is all about decentralization - rather than relying on a central data team to manage all of an organization's data, a data mesh encourages each individual team or business unit to take ownership of their own data. This can lead to faster and more effective decision-making, as well as a greater level of accountability across the organization.

To make a data mesh work, there are several key principles that need to be followed. These include things like creating domain-oriented data teams, implementing a federated data governance model, and using modern data infrastructure tools and technologies. By doing these things, organizations can create a data mesh that is flexible, scalable, and tailored to the specific needs of their business.

What are some of the benefits of a data mesh?

A data mesh can provide a number of benefits that can help organizations better manage and leverage their data.

  1. Improved data quality: When individual teams are responsible for managing their own data, they are more likely to take ownership of it and ensure that it is accurate and up-to-date. This can lead to improved data quality and more reliable insights.
  2. Increased agility: By decentralizing data management, a data mesh can help organizations move more quickly and respond more effectively to changing business needs. Teams can make decisions based on the data they have at their disposal, without waiting for a central data team to provide them with the information they need
  3. Greater accountability: When teams are responsible for managing their own data, they are also accountable for the outcomes that result from that data. This can lead to a greater level of accountability across the organization and a stronger focus on delivering value.
  4. Better collaboration: A data mesh encourages cross-functional collaboration and knowledge-sharing, as teams work together to ensure that data is consistent and accurate across the organization. This can lead to more effective decision-making and better outcomes for the business.
  5. Scalability: A data mesh is designed to be flexible and scalable, allowing organizations to adapt to changing data management needs as they grow and evolve. This can help ensure that the organization's data infrastructure can keep pace with the demands of the business.

What are the core components of a data mesh approach?

The data mesh approach to data management is based on several core components, which together help to create a flexible and scalable data architecture that can meet the needs of modern organizations. Here are some of the key components of a data mesh:

  • Domain-oriented data teams: One of the key principles of a data mesh is the creation of domain-oriented data teams, which are responsible for managing data within a specific business domain or functional area. This helps to ensure that data is managed by people who have the expertise and context needed to understand it fully.
  • Federated data governance: In a data mesh, data governance is decentralized, with each domain-oriented data team responsible for the data they manage. However, there is still a need for overall governance, and a federated governance model is used to ensure that data is managed consistently across the organization.
  • Self-serve data infrastructure: A data mesh relies on modern data infrastructure tools and technologies that enable teams to access and manage data in a self-serve manner. This can include things like data catalogs, data discovery tools, and data pipelines that allow teams to easily discover, access, and analyze the data they need.
  • Data products: In a data mesh, each domain-oriented data team is responsible for creating data products that are tailored to the needs of their specific business area. These products can include things like data pipelines, data models, and data services that are designed to be reusable across the organization.
  • Collaborative culture: Finally, a data mesh relies on a collaborative culture that encourages cross-functional communication and knowledge-sharing. By working together to manage data effectively, teams can create a more integrated and holistic view of the organization's data.
  • API-first design: To enable seamless integration and interoperability between data products, a data mesh approach relies on an API-first design. This means that data products are designed with APIs that allow them to be easily consumed and integrated by other teams and systems.

What are some industries that can truly leverage the power of a data mesh approach?

The data mesh approach to data management can be beneficial for any industry that relies on data to drive decision-making and improve outcomes. However, there are some industries that can truly leverage the power of a data mesh approach due to their unique data challenges and requirements. Here are a few examples:

  1. Finance services: Financial services organizations generate vast amounts of data on a daily basis, from customer transactions to market data. By using a data mesh approach, these organizations can ensure that data is managed by domain-oriented teams that have the expertise needed to understand it fully, while also adhering to strict governance and compliance standards.
  2. Healthcare: The healthcare industry is another industry that generates a tremendous amount of data, from patient records to clinical trial data. A data mesh approach can help healthcare organizations to manage this data more effectively, by enabling domain-oriented teams to take ownership of their own data, and creating data products that are tailored to the needs of specific healthcare domains.
  3. E-commerce: E-commerce companies rely on data to drive sales and improve customer experience. A data mesh approach can help these companies to manage data more effectively, by enabling domain-oriented teams to take ownership of their own data, and creating data products that are tailored to the needs of specific e-commerce domains.
  4. Manufacturing: Manufacturing companies generate vast amounts of data on their production processes, from sensors and equipment monitoring to supply chain data. By using a data mesh approach, these organizations can ensure that data is managed by domain-oriented teams that have the expertise needed to understand it fully, while also enabling data products that can improve production efficiency and reduce costs.
  5. Media and entertainment: Media and entertainment companies generate a wide variety of data, from user engagement metrics to content consumption patterns. By using a data mesh approach, these organizations can enable domain-oriented teams to take ownership of their own data, and create data products that can help to drive content recommendations, advertising revenue, and audience engagement.

How can businesses define the successful use of a data mesh approach?

Defining the successful use of a data mesh approach requires a clear understanding of the goals and objectives of the business, as well as the specific challenges and opportunities presented by the organization's data landscape. Here are a few key factors that businesses can use to define the successful use of a data mesh approach:

  1. Improved data quality: One of the primary goals of a data mesh approach is to improve the quality of the organization's data. By enabling domain-oriented teams to take ownership of their own data, and providing them with the tools and infrastructure they need to manage it effectively, businesses can ensure that their data is accurate, consistent, and up-to-date.
  2. Faster time-to-insight: Another key benefit of a data mesh approach is that it can help businesses to gain insights from their data more quickly. By creating data products that are tailored to the needs of specific domains, and enabling teams to easily discover, access, and analyze the data they need, businesses can reduce the time and effort required to gain insights from their data.
  3. Increased collaboration: A successful data mesh approach requires a culture of collaboration that encourages cross-functional communication and knowledge-sharing. By working together to manage data effectively, teams can create a more integrated and holistic view of the organization's data, and make more informed decisions as a result.
  4. Improved agility and scalability: A data mesh approach is designed to be flexible and scalable, enabling businesses to adapt to changing data needs and requirements. By empowering domain-oriented teams to take ownership of their own data, businesses can ensure that they are able to respond quickly and effectively to new challenges and opportunities.
  5. Improved business outcomes: Ultimately, the success of a data mesh approach should be measured by its impact on business outcomes. By using data more effectively to drive decision-making and improve outcomes, businesses can achieve tangible benefits such as increased revenue, reduced costs, and improved customer satisfaction.

By focusing on these key factors, businesses can define the successful use of a data mesh approach in a way that is aligned with their overall goals and objectives.

Understand the value of Cloudera's scalable data mesh and modern data architectures

Drive efficiencies in both cost and value by scaling data and information systems with a data mesh.

Scalable Data Mesh

Overcome the limitations of traditional monolithic data architectures by enabling teams to manage and serve data-as-a-product across the organization.

Learn more

Open Data Lakehouse

Deploy anywhere, on any cloud or in your data center, wherever your data resides with an open data lakehouse.

Learn more

Cloudera Data Platform

Span multi-cloud and on premises with an open data lakehouse that delivers cloud-native data analytics across the full data lifecycle.

Learn more

Your form submission has failed.

This may have been caused by one of the following:

  • Your request timed out
  • A plugin/browser extension blocked the submission. If you have an ad blocking plugin please disable it and close this message to reload the page.